RHEUMATISM BANISHED.

ZAM-BUK GAINS GREAT PRAISE

"I suffered with Rheumatism in my left leg," says Mr Peter Wienert, of Cameron's Creek, Cooktown, Q. "It was ©specially severe about the knee, and, although I tried many professed remedies, I could not get rid of it. Seeing Zam-Buk advertised as a cure for Rheumatism, I purchased a pot and applied the balm, rubbing it well into the parts affected. The relief was immediate, and I continued the treatment until the pot and a half was consumed, by which tinis the pains had left me entirely, and have not since returned. I am'a" farmer, and fully appreciate the necessity of always keeping such a reliable healing balm handy, in cases of emergency." Zam-Buk fs a proved euro for Piles, Eczema, Boils, Running Sores, Sore Legs, Ringworm, Rheumatism, Lumbago, Sciatica, etc. As an embrocation for Strained Muscles and Tendons, Zam-Buk rubbed well into the parts affected, is unequalled. As a household Balm for Cuts, Bruises, Pimples, Blackheads, Sore Throat, Sore Chest, Chapped Hands, Chilblains, and Sore Feet, Zam-Buk is invaluable. Fiom all Medicine* Vendors at Is 6d, or 3s 6d family size (containing nearly four times the quantity), or from The Zani-Buk Co., 39 Pitt Street, Sydney.
